Understanding the Risk-Reward Dynamic

The fundamental principle governing the aviator game, and its appeal, lies in its escalating risk-reward system. As the plane ascends, the multiplier increases, amplifying the potential payout. This creates a compelling incentive to hold on, to push your luck for a more significant return. However, the longer you wait, the greater the likelihood that the plane will “fly away,” resulting in the loss of your entire stake. This creates a potent psychological tension – the fear of losing versus the lure of a larger win. Mastering this tension is key to successful gameplay. Many players gravitate towards this game because it simulates, in a very compact and immediate sense, the larger risks and rewards found in financial markets, but without the need for extensive market analysis or long-term commitment.

The game isn't purely based on chance. While the moment the plane flies away is determined by a random number generator, skilled players can implement strategies to mitigate risk and enhance their winning probability. These strategies range from conservative approaches, such as cashing out with small multipliers, to more aggressive tactics, aiming for higher payouts. A key element is understanding the game’s statistics and recognizing patterns, though it’s crucial to remember that past performance is not indicative of future results. The volatility inherent in the game is a significant factor, and players must be prepared for both winning and losing streaks.

Strategies for Mitigating Risk

Implementing a sound risk management strategy is crucial in the aviator game. One popular approach is the “martingale” system, where players double their bet after each loss, hoping to recover their previous losses with a single win. However, this system requires a substantial bankroll and carries the risk of quickly depleting funds if a losing streak persists. Another strategy involves setting predefined profit targets and stop-loss limits. For instance, a player might decide to cash out when the multiplier reaches 2.0, or stop playing if they lose a certain percentage of their initial bankroll. These predetermined rules help remove emotional decision-making from the equation and prevent impulsive behavior. Diversifying bets, by placing smaller bets on multiple rounds, can also help spread risk.

Ultimately, the best strategy depends on the player’s risk tolerance and financial goals. A conservative player might prioritize preserving their capital and opting for frequent, smaller wins, while a more aggressive player might be willing to risk larger amounts for the potential of a significant payout. It's important to remember that the aviator game is a form of entertainment, and should be approached as such. Chasing losses or attempting to “beat the system” is rarely a successful strategy, and can lead to financial hardship.

The Psychological Aspects of Gameplay

Beyond the mathematical probabilities, the aviator game taps into fundamental psychological principles that make it incredibly engaging. The near-miss effect, where the plane nearly flies away before a player cashes out, can be particularly potent, creating a sense of excitement and reinforcing the desire to play again. The variable ratio reinforcement schedule, where rewards are delivered unpredictably, keeps players hooked and motivated to continue playing. This is the same principle that makes slot machines so addictive. The visual simplicity of the game contributes to its hypnotic effect, allowing players to become fully immersed in the experience. The escalating multiplier also creates a sense of urgency, prompting players to make quick decisions under pressure.

Understanding these psychological factors is crucial for maintaining control and preventing impulsive behavior. Recognizing when you’re being swayed by emotions, rather than logic, is a key skill. It also crucial to set time limits and stick to them – the immersive nature of the game can easily lead to hours spent chasing wins. It is easy to fall into the trap of thinking that “the next round will be the one,” but this is rarely the case. The game is designed to be captivating, and it’s important to be aware of its persuasive techniques.

The Evolution of Online Crash Games

The aviator game isn’t an isolated phenomenon; it’s part of a broader trend of “crash” games gaining popularity in the online gambling world. These games share a common mechanic: a multiplier that increases over time, with the potential to “crash” at any moment, resulting in a loss. The appeal lies in their simplicity, fast-paced action, and the potential for quick wins. Early iterations of crash games were often found on cryptocurrency gambling platforms, leveraging the anonymity and speed of blockchain transactions. However, the popularity of the genre has expanded to traditional online casinos, attracting a wider audience. This evolution has involved increasing sophistication in game design, incorporating features like auto-cashout options, chat functionality, and social elements.

The rise of crash games can be attributed to several factors. Firstly, their simplicity makes them accessible to players who are new to online gambling. Secondly, the fast-paced gameplay caters to the short attention spans of modern audiences. Thirdly, the potential for large payouts creates a strong sense of excitement and anticipation. Furthermore, the social aspect of many crash games, where players can chat and share their experiences, adds an extra layer of engagement. The accessibility via mobile devices allows for gameplay on the go, capitalizing on the convenience modern users expect.
